Job Description

Phoenix Cyber is looking for security focused Python programmers to help develop custom plugins and 3rd party integrations for a commercial-off-the-shelf cybersecurity software product. The work involves designing, developing, and implementing data models, index structures, and storage strategies; ingesting/indexing processes and transforming/normalizing data to common standards using log aggregation tools (e.g., Elasticsearch and Splunk); enriching data upon ingest and querying; and creating queries against big data.

This is a 100% remote, work-from-home position anywhere in the continental United States.
